Output a342615cdafb28974b1e325feb3c25b409da8d384a11d1ecaff0a9357256d31e: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1dec00266b92e7a7a2810bddac2099551b1a45f OP_EQUAL
address
3PjucieAK7qUcq9XjAiBKN8cfo6yeyP2zZ
transaction
a342615cdafb28974b1e325feb3c25b409da8d384a11d1ecaff0a9357256d31e
spent
true